Tabitha is an interesting looking lady who's age is a total guess to us. She looks like she's older, but she doesn't act like a senior. So we don't really know what to think! Tabitha can be more on the independent side. But she still loves her humans and is an excellent alarm clock to remind you when dinner is. She LOVES wet food. If you open a cat of food, you can bet Tabitha will be running to the bowl as soon as she hears the lid crack! She loves getting her fur brushed, climbing her cat tree, chasing jingle balls across the floor, and investigating all areas of the house to see if anything new is happening. She has lived with dogs, cats, and kids in the past and did great with everyone! While in rescue, Tabitha received a dental check to make sure that her teeth are healthy, The vets also noted that she had a lump on her throat next to her trachea. Bloodwork was run and we had a cytology done on the lump which showed inflammation. So nothing crazy! But her future family should continue to monitor the lump to ensure it doesn't grow or change. Tabitha is fixed, microchipped, FIV/FeLV negative, and up to date on vaccinations for their age. I adopted Maya a few years ago from a womens sober living facility that fostered other cats. Maya, God bless her heart, is a very anxious baby and does not do well with change. She had been a great addition to my household until there were some recent changes - I took in a dog (for security reasons), I moved into a new place, and my daughter came into this world. I think these changes really stressed her out to the point where she is now always hiding and does a poor job at cleaning herself. I feel absolutely awful about needing to re-home her as I do love her very much, however, she just is not thriving like how she did in the past and there is nothing I can do about it. It is my hope that she will do better at her next home. I think she would do well somewhere with minimal activity and no dogs. She did well with my other cat until the recent changes, so being around other cats should be fine. Maya is normally a very social and cuddly cat. She purrs obnoxiously loud and LOVES people!
